獲取類的成員變數和屬性:
在objc_class中,所有的成員變數、屬性的資訊是放在連結串列ivars中的。ivars是一個數組,陣列中每個元素是指向Ivar(變數資訊)的指標。runtime提供了豐富的函式來操作這一欄位。大體上可以分為以下幾類:
1.成員變數操作函式,主要包含以下函式:
// 獲取類中指定名稱例項成員變數的資訊 Ivar class_getInstanceVariable ( Class cls, const char *name ); // 獲取類成員變數的資訊 Ivar class_getClassVariable ( Class cls, const char *name ); // 新增成員變數 BOOL class_addIvar ( Class cls, const char *name, size_t size, uint8_t alignment, const char *types ); // 獲取整個成員變數列表 Ivar * class_copyIvarList ( Class cls, unsigned int *outCount );
class_getInstanceVariable函式,它返回一個指向包含name指定的成員變數資訊的objc_ivar結構體的指標(Ivar)。
class_getClassVariable函式,目前沒有找到關於Objective-C中類變數的資訊,一般認為Objective-C不支援類變數。注意,返回的列表不包含父類的成員變數和屬性。
Objective-C不支援往已存在的類中新增例項變數,因此不管是系統庫提供的提供的類,還是我們自定義的類,都無法動態新增成員變數。但如果我們通過執行時來建立一個類的話,又應該如何給它新增成員變數呢?這時我們就可以使用class_addIvar函數了。不過需要注意的是,這個方法只能在objc_allocateClassPair函式與objc_registerClassPair之間呼叫。另外,這個類也不能是元類。成員變數的按位元組最小對齊量是1<
class_copyIvarList函式,它返回一個指向成員變數資訊的陣列,陣列中每個元素是指向該成員變數資訊的objc_ivar結構體的指標。這個陣列不包含在父類中宣告的變數。outCount指標返回陣列的大小。需要注意的是,我們必須使用free()來釋放這個陣列。
2.屬性操作函式,主要包含以下函式:
// 獲取指定的屬性 objc_property_t class_getProperty ( Class cls, const char *name ); // 獲取屬性列表 objc_property_t * class_copyPropertyList ( Class cls, unsigned int *outCount ); // 為類新增屬性 BOOL class_addProperty ( Class cls, const char *name, const objc_property_attribute_t *attributes, unsigned int attributeCount ); // 替換類的屬性 void class_replaceProperty ( Class cls, const char *name, const objc_property_attribute_t *attributes, unsigned int attributeCount );
這一種方法也是針對ivars來操作,不過只操作那些是屬性的值。我們在後面介紹屬性時會再遇到這些函式。
例項:
//-----------------------------------------------------------
// MyClass.h
@interface MyClass : NSObject @property (nonatomic, strong) NSArray *array;
@property (nonatomic, copy) NSString *string;
- (void)method1;
- (void)method2;
+ (void)classMethod1;
@end
//-----------------------------------------------------------
// MyClass.m
#import "MyClass.h"
@interface MyClass () {
NSInteger _instance1;
NSString * _instance2;
}
@property (nonatomic, assign) NSUInteger integer;
- (void)method3WithArg1:(NSInteger)arg1 arg2:(NSString *)arg2;
@end
@implementation MyClass
+ (void)classMethod1 {
}
- (void)method1 {
NSLog(@"call method method1");
}
- (void)method2 {
}
- (void)method3WithArg1:(NSInteger)arg1 arg2:(NSString *)arg2 {
NSLog(@"arg1 : %ld, arg2 : %@", arg1, arg2);
}
@end
MyClass *myClass = [[MyClass alloc] init];
unsigned int outCount = 0;
Class cls = myClass.class;
// 類名
NSLog(@"class name: %s", class_getName(cls));
NSLog(@"==========================================================");
// 父類
NSLog(@"super class name: %s", class_getName(class_getSuperclass(cls)));
NSLog(@"==========================================================");
// 是否是元類
NSLog(@"MyClass is %@ a meta-class", (class_isMetaClass(cls) ? @"" : @"not"));
NSLog(@"==========================================================");
Class meta_class = objc_getMetaClass(class_getName(cls));
NSLog(@"%s's meta-class is %s", class_getName(cls), class_getName(meta_class));
NSLog(@"==========================================================");
// 變數例項大小
NSLog(@"instance size: %zu", class_getInstanceSize(cls));
NSLog(@"==========================================================");
// 成員變數
Ivar *ivars = class_copyIvarList(cls, &outCount);
for (int i = 0; i < outCount; i++) {
Ivar ivar = ivars[i];
NSLog(@"instance variable's name: %s at index: %d", ivar_getName(ivar), i);
}
free(ivars);
Ivar string = class_getInstanceVariable(cls, "_string");
if (string != NULL) {
NSLog(@"instace variable %s", ivar_getName(string));
}
NSLog(@"==========================================================");
// 屬性操作
objc_property_t * properties = class_copyPropertyList(cls, &outCount);
for (int i = 0; i < outCount; i++) {
objc_property_t property = properties[i];
NSLog(@"property's name: %s", property_getName(property));
}
free(properties);
objc_property_t array = class_getProperty(cls, "array");
if (array != NULL) {
NSLog(@"property %s", property_getName(array));
}
NSLog(@"==========================================================");
// 方法操作
Method *methods = class_copyMethodList(cls, &outCount);
for (int i = 0; i < outCount; i++) {
Method method = methods[i];
NSLog(@"method's signature: %s", method_getName(method));
}
free(methods);
Method method1 = class_getInstanceMethod(cls, @selector(method1));
if (method1 != NULL) {
NSLog(@"method %s", method_getName(method1));
}
Method classMethod = class_getClassMethod(cls, @selector(classMethod1));
if (classMethod != NULL) {
NSLog(@"class method : %s", method_getName(classMethod));
}
NSLog(@"MyClass is%@ responsd to selector: method3WithArg1:arg2:", class_respondsToSelector(cls, @selector(method3WithArg1:arg2:)) ? @"" : @" not");
IMP imp = class_getMethodImplementation(cls, @selector(method1));
imp();
NSLog(@"==========================================================");
// 協議
Protocol * __unsafe_unretained * protocols = class_copyProtocolList(cls, &outCount);
Protocol * protocol;
for (int i = 0; i < outCount; i++) {
protocol = protocols[i];
NSLog(@"protocol name: %s", protocol_getName(protocol));
}
NSLog(@"MyClass is%@ responsed to protocol %s", class_conformsToProtocol(cls, protocol) ? @"" : @" not", protocol_getName(protocol));
NSLog(@"==========================================================");
